J. Nick Koston
7b016063ca
Refactor zeroconf setup to be async ( #39955 )
...
* Refactor zeroconf setup to be async
Most of the setup was calling back to async because
we were setting up listeners. Since we only need
to jump into the executor to create the zeroconf
instance, its much faster to setup in async.
In testing this cut the setup time in half
or better.

J. Nick Koston
49478298cc
Ensure service browser does not collapse on bad dns names ( #38851 )
...
If a device on the network presented a bad name, zeroconf
would throw zeroconf.BadTypeInNameException and the service
browser would die off. We now trap the exception and continue.

J. Nick Koston
3315c4c6c3
Pre-filter zeroconf service browser updates ( #35518 )
...
Each ServerBrowser currently runs in its own thread which
processes every A or AAAA record update per instance.
As the list of zeroconf names we watch for grows, each additional
ServiceBrowser would process all the A and AAAA updates on the network.
To avoid overwhemling the system we pre-filter here and only process
DNSPointers for the configured record name (type)
